    Cowden syndrome is a rare autosomal dominant familial cancer syndrome with a high risk of breast cancer. The most important clinical features include carcinomas of the breast and thyroid, and hamartomatous polyps of the gastrointestinal tract. There are characteristic mucocutaneous features which allow early recognition of the disease and are generally present before internal malignancies develop. We report on a woman in whom the diagnosis of Cowden syndrome was first made after she had been treated for both breast cancer and melanoma. Copyright (C) 2001 S. KargerAG, Basel

    ABSTRACT To examine what happens at the intersection of policy and practice, this dissertation utilizes a three-article format to advance public administration scholarship and contribute to health system research about occupational therapy. This work creates bridging links between public administration scholarship in the areas of street-level bureaucracy and policy alienation and the occupational therapy profession. The articles combine to inform the occupational therapy community by providing empirical findings to validate role conflict and professional alienation experiences of practicing occupational therapy professionals when implementing policy in practice. The Article One thesis asserts that while policy content matters, it is vital to understand the context of policy, and by extension, the context of practice as a response to policy implementation. Drawing on institutional theory, this work offers an historical review of policy-specific critical junctures in occupational history and how policy has influenced occupational therapy practice. Article Two connects institutional theory, street-level bureaucracy scholarship, and policy alienation research to explain the experience of role conflict related to implementation of productivity standards for occupational therapy professionals. Article Three utilizes street-level bureaucracy theory and policy alienation scholarship to provide the foundation for introducing “professional alienation” as an extension of policy alienation constructs. The article examines the extent to which occupational therapy professionals feel pressured to alienate core professional values, such as client-centered care, in practice. Articles Two and Three present the empirical findings from this original research study, which employed online survey methodology to explore the relationship of professional profile characteristics and work context factors with the two dependent variables of interest – role conflict and professional alienation. T-tests and multiple regression analyses indicate that professional profile characteristics such as professional credential/status and direct treatment provider designation influence role conflict and professional alienation. Work context factors that contribute to role conflict and professional alienation appear related to practice parameters and policy expectations in specific practice environments such as long term care/skilled nursing facilities and pediatric practice settings. This study lends support for future research including frontline storytelling of occupational therapy professionals, exploration of context differences, and coping strategies of frontline workers

    This article reviews post-1974 scholarly literature on women’s leadership in academic libraries, with the emphasis on the United States. The purpose of this synthesis is to highlight research areas and themes that have significantly expanded the profession’s knowledge about gender and its impact at the top administrative level. The article starts with a brief overview of theories of gender and leadership before tracing scholarship on the gendered career patterns singled out in Schiller’s work (1974). The article then focuses on additional issues related to gender and library administration, including leadership styles, perceptions of differences between male and female leaders, and the lack of diversity among academic library women directors

    Aim Sleep-disturbed breathing (SDB) is common in pre-capillary pulmonary hypertension (PH) and impairs daytime performance. In lack of proven effective treatments, we tested whether nocturnal oxygen therapy (NOT) or acetazolamide improve exercise performance and quality of life in patients with pre-capillary PH and SDB. Methods This was a randomized, placebo-controlled, double-blind, three period cross-over trial. Participants received NOT (3 L/min), acetazolamide tablets (2 × 250 mg), and sham-NOT/placebo tablets each during 1 week with 1-week washout between treatment periods. Twenty-three patients, 16 with pulmonary arterial PH, 7 with chronic thromboembolic PH, and with SDB defined as mean nocturnal oxygen saturation 10 h−1 with daytime PaO2 ≄7.3 kPa participated. Assessments at the end of the treatment periods included a 6 min walk distance (MWD), SF-36 quality of life, polysomnography, and echocardiography. Results Medians (quartiles) of the 6 MWD after NOT, acetazolamide, and placebo were 480 m (390;528), 440 m (368;468), and 454 m (367;510), respectively, mean differences: NOT vs. placebo +25 m (95% CI 3-46, P= 0.027), acetazolamide vs. placebo −9 m (−34-17, P = 0.223), and NOT vs. acetazolamide +33 (12-45, P < 0.001). SF-36 quality of life was similar with all treatments. Nocturnal oxygen saturation significantly improved with both NOT and acetazolamide. Right ventricular fractional area change was greater on NOT compared with placebo (P = 0.042) and acetazolamide (P = 0.027). Conclusions In patients with pre-capillary PH and SDB on optimized pharmacological therapy, NOT improved the 6 MWD compared with placebo already after 1 week along with improvements in SDB and haemodynamics.     Groundwater quality and quantity is of extreme importance as it is a source of drinking water in the United States. One major concern has emerged due to the possible contamination of groundwater from unconventional oil and natural gas extraction activities. Recent studies have been performed to understand if these activities are causing groundwater contamination, particularly with respect to exogenous hydrocarbons and volatile organic compounds. The impact of contaminants on microbial ecology is an area to be explored as alternatives for water treatment are necessary. In this work, we identified cultivable organic-degrading bacteria in groundwater in close proximity to unconventional natural gas extraction. Pseudomonas stutzeri and Acinetobacter haemolyticus were identified using matrix-assisted laser desorption/ionization-time-of-flight-mass spectrometry (MALDI-TOF MS), which proved to be a simple, fast, and reliable method. Additionally, the potential use of the identified bacteria in water and/or wastewater bioremediation was studied by determining the ability of these microorganisms to degrade toluene and chloroform. In fact, these bacteria can be potentially applied for in situ bioremediation of contaminated water and wastewater treatment, as they were able to degrade both compounds.info:eu-repo/semantics/publishedVersio

    Hydroxyl radical (OH) emissions are relevant for oxidation reactions in the post flame chemistry of exhaust gases emitted from jet engines. No direct measurements of OH concentrations are available to date due to the low abundance and the short lifetime of this radical species. The first application of a combined technique based on Raman scattering and laser_induced fluorescence (LIF) spectrometry is presented here for measurements in the exhaust gases of a commercial jet engine operated in a test rig. From the measurements, upper limits for OH concentrations in the exit plane were determined in the range of 90 ppbv for take off and 80 ppbv for ap_idle. The values are significantly below the predictions of model calculations based on HONO and HNO3 in_flight concentration measurements presented recently. Possibilities for further increase of the detection sensitivity for OH are discussed.Peer Reviewedhttp://deepblue.lib.umich.edu/bitstream/2027.42/86750/1/Sick34.pd

    The production of charged pions, protons and deuterons has been studied in central collisions of 58Ni on 58Ni at incident beam energies of 1.06, 1.45 and 1.93 AGeV. The dependence of transverse-momentum and rapidity spectra on the beam energy and on the centrality of the collison is presented. It is shown that the scaling of the mean rapidity shift of protons established for AGS and SPS energies is valid down to 1 AGeV. The degree of nuclear stopping is discussed; the IQMD transport model reproduces the measured proton rapidity spectra for the most central events reasonably well, but does not show any sensitivity between the soft and the hard equation of state (EoS). A radial flow analysis, using the midrapidity transverse-momentum spectra, delivers freeze-out temperatures T and radial flow velocities beta_r which increase with beam energy up to 2 AGeV; in comparison to existing data of Au on Au over a large range of energies only beta_r shows a system size dependence
